Responsibilities:
Prepare detailed estimates for fire alarm and low-voltage projects
Perform takeoffs and equipment lists using plans, specifications, and scope documents
Apply Texas fire alarm code requirements to system layouts and quantities
- Estimate and support low-voltage systems including:
Fire alarm systems (Siemens and Fire-Lite)
CCTV and video surveillance
Intercom systems
Access control
Security and alarm systems
Work closely with sales personnel to support bidding and proposal preparation
Check equipment pricing, quantities, and system requirements for accuracy
Coordinate with internal team members to clarify scope, site conditions, or missing information
Use Microsoft 365 tools for documentation, spreadsheets, collaboration, and reporting
Maintain organized, accurate estimating files and documentation
Communicate clearly and professionally with internal stakeholders
